Thank you to the publisher and BookishFirst for this ARC in exchange for an honest review!

Courageous Faith by Dr. Debbye Turner Bell is a Christian self-help book by a beauty pageant winner. The author is famous for being Miss America 1990, but her entire life wasn't crowns and sashes. She has experienced her own share of ups and downs. She's experienced feeling not good enough. She's faced her inner demons and survives. Thanks to her life experiences, she has plenty of advice for Christians who are going through a rough patch. She wants to help all of her readers to experienced victory and faith in God.

Here is an excerpt from the Prologue:

"As Miss America, I especially enjoyed speaking with young
people. I could be me—just Debbye—the girl who had a dream
come true. I encouraged young people to dream big, to work
hard, and to never give up. I used my own journey to the
Miss America crown as an example of how they could succeed
against the odds.
My goal for this book is the same. I want you to dream
big, work hard, never give up—and succeed. Succeed in being
and doing all that God has for you in this life. Nothing less!"

Overall, Courageous Faith is an interesting self-help book for Christians. I've never read a book written by a beauty pageant winner before, so that made this book interesting to me. (Side note: One of my favorite reality TV shows was Lifetime's Kim of Queens, but that is literally the extent of my knowledge of beauty pageants.) The author also does a good job of balancing general life advice with faith-based advice from a Christian perspective. If you're intrigued by the excerpt above, or if you enjoy reading Christian self-help books, I recommend that you check out this book, which is available now!

Thank you in advance to the publisher, Our Daily Bread Publishing, for providing a complimentary review copy through BookishFirst. A positive review was not required and all words are my own.

With a tagline referring to FAITH OVER FEAR, it is a good bet this is written by a Christian person for Christian readers.

If you're Atheist, Agnostic, or not Christian in your faith - this book simply will not appeal to you.

This is not a NOVEL as in "fiction". This is definitely a "self-help" type read. And, it comes from a former Miss America title holder. What makes this interesting is that at a moment of low self-esteem she questioned God about her losses in certain pageants. That alone is reaching out to girls and women who struggle with self-esteem by showing them anyone can suffer it.

Turner-Bell recounts certain events in her life from miscarriages and other events and relied on faith to push forward. She uses that as a tool to guide others. It also shaped her mindset, personality, and drive forward. She also shows us that our events do not define us - how we handle them does.

Definitely enjoyed this read and didn't even know about her until I got this book.

Inspiring and personal

Sometimes a book comes into my life unexpectedly and ends up being something I truly needed to read at that exact moment of my life. This inspirational and honest book became that for me.

This author's faith in God was never perfect; she shared her journey along God's path for her with personal details of her successes and failures in trusting that God has everything in control. I felt her pain of losing her mom to cancer and the deep grief she allowed herself to get lost in. I also felt the joy of pulling herself up and deepening her faith because of this hole in her life. She shared both her brokenness and healing and this was my favorite part of her writing.

Throughout the book, the author also coaches her readers and encourages them to take honest looks into themselves to find their own unique God-given strengths and talents and not compare themselves to others, depend on others for sense of worth, and to not judge the actions of other people. She shows her readers through so many personal examples that God hears every prayer and even if he doesn't answer right away (her teenage prayer about marriage wasn't answered until her late 30s!), God does answer every prayer. God may not answer in a way you want, but it is part of His plan. This faith kept the author going and taught her to persevere in all times. She reminded me that "Prayer should be a lifestyle....it is as elemental to our life, faith, and survival as air, food, and water." p.45

Thanks to Our Daily Bread & NetGalley for a digital advance reader copy. All comments and opinions are my own.

I didn't know who Debbye Turner Bell was before reading this memoir, but now she feels like a friend. She honestly and authentically tells her own story of how she depended on God throughout her life, highlighting her odyssey in becoming Miss America, her broadcast career, her marathon running, her search for a husband, their determination to build their family, and above all her spiritual growth and her "pursuit of faith over fear."

Throughout the book Debbye describes how she listens to and trusts God, and quotes scripture as evidence of the foundation of her faith. Each of the book's ten chapters explains another stage in her life as she grows stronger: from "Failure" to "Faith," "Determination" to "Excellence," all the way to "Overcoming" and finally to "Perseverance." Debbye returns again and again to the qualities of the title and how she couldn't have achieved the successes without the "Courageous Faith" from God.

Debbye's story is an encouragement any reader will appreciate. The book includes a short series of questions in each chapter that can be used as discussion questions for a group, or a way to pause and think about how God may be working in the reader's life.

This book would make a nice gift for anyone who wants to pursue a life of "faith over fear."
